回答編集履歴
2
修正
answer
CHANGED
@@ -1,3 +1,5 @@
|
|
1
1
|
今となっては `NULL` のほうがいいかと思う。
|
2
2
|
なぜなら、MySQL5.7 からは(デフォルト設定では)、`0000-00-00 00:00:00` はエラーとして扱う。
|
3
|
-
つまりバージョンアップはできなくなる。
|
3
|
+
つまりバージョンアップはできなくなる。
|
4
|
+
|
5
|
+
少なくともMySQLの開発チームは `0000-00-00 00:00:00` ってデータが入るのはおかしいと言う結論に達しているのであろうから、それに従うほうが良いでしょう。
|
1
追記
answer
CHANGED
@@ -1,3 +1,3 @@
|
|
1
1
|
今となっては `NULL` のほうがいいかと思う。
|
2
|
-
なぜなら、MySQL5.7 からは、`0000-00-00 00:00:00` はエラーとして扱う。
|
2
|
+
なぜなら、MySQL5.7 からは(デフォルト設定では)、`0000-00-00 00:00:00` はエラーとして扱う。
|
3
3
|
つまりバージョンアップはできなくなる。
|